(a) Application fees paid to DSHS are not transferable
and may be reimbursed only if:
(1) fee amounts are paid in excess of the required
fee, including as a result of an error in the online payment system,
and DSHS deducts an administrative fee, as specified in §296.91(c)(17)
of this chapter (relating to Fees) and subscription and convenience
fees, as specified in §296.91(b) of this chapter from an excess
payment before issuing a refund; or
(2) an application is not processed within the time
periods described in §296.42(b) of this chapter (relating to
Initial and Renewal Applications).
(A) In that event, the applicant has the right to request
reimbursement of the application fee in writing.
(B) A request for reimbursement may be denied if DSHS
does not determine that the applicable time period has been exceeded
or finds that there was good cause for exceeding the time period.
(C) Good cause for exceeding the time period exists
if:
(i) the number of license applications to be processed
exceeds the number of applications processed in the same calendar
quarter of the preceding year by 15% or more;
(ii) DSHS relies on another public or private entity
to process all or part of the application process and that entity
causes the delay; or
(iii) any other condition exists that gives DSHS good
cause for exceeding the time period.
(b) If DSHS denies a request for reimbursement under
subsection (a)(2) of this section, the applicant may appeal in writing
to the commissioner. If the commissioner determines that DSHS exceeded
the applicable processing time period without good cause, the applicant
is entitled to reimbursement of all application fees paid after being
notified in writing of the decision.
